Male mating patterns in wild multimale mountain gorilla groups.

Abstract

Although mountain gorillas, Gorilla gorilla beringei, are classified as having a one-male mating system, approximately 40% of the social units are multimale groups. I observed two multimale groups of mountain gorillas at the Karisoke Research Center, Rwanda, Africa, for 17 months to determine male mating patterns and male-male mating harassment in relation to both male dominance rank and female reproductive status. Dominant males mated significantly more than did individual subordinate males, and dominant males mated more with cycling adult and pregnant females. The dominant males participated in 47 and 83% of observed matings in the two groups. Subordinate males were more likely than dominant males to mate with subadult females. Eleven of 14 females were observed to mate with more than one male, and multiple males mated with three of the five females observed at the probable time of conception. Mating harassment was initiated and received by both dominant and subordinate males. Mating harassment occurred infrequently (during 30 and 22% of matings in each group), usually consisted of mild aggression, and usually terminated copulations by subordinate males, but not those by dominant males. These results suggest that multimale mountain gorilla groups can be favourable environments for subordinate males to obtain mating opportunities. Dominant males may be unable or unwilling to prevent subordinate males from mating. Based on behavioural observations, mountain gorillas can have a multimale mating system but further research on the role of females in male mating success and paternity determination is needed to understand fully this species' mating system. 尽管山地大猩猩(Gorilla gorilla beringei)被归类为具有单雄交配系统,但约40%的社会单元是多雄群体。我在非洲卢旺达的卡里索凯研究中心对两组多雄山地大猩猩进行了17个月的观察,以确定雄性的交配模式以及与雄性优势等级和雌性生殖状态相关的雄-雄交配骚扰情况。优势雄性的交配次数显著多于单个从属雄性,且优势雄性与处于发情期的成年雌性和怀孕雌性的交配更多。在这两组中,优势雄性参与了47%和83%的观察到的交配。从属雄性比优势雄性更有可能与亚成年雌性交配。观察到14只雌性中有11只与不止一只雄性交配,并且在可能的受孕时期,多只雄性与观察到的5只雌性中的3只交配。优势雄性和从属雄性都会发起并遭受交配骚扰。交配骚扰很少发生(每组交配过程中的发生率分别为30%和22%),通常由轻度攻击行为构成,并且通常会终止从属雄性的交配行为,但不会终止优势雄性的交配行为。这些结果表明,多雄山地大猩猩群体对于从属雄性来说可能是获得交配机会的有利环境。优势雄性可能无法或不愿意阻止从属雄性交配。基于行为观察,山地大猩猩可以具有多雄交配系统,但需要进一步研究雌性在雄性交配成功和父权确定中的作用,以全面了解该物种的交配系统。版权所有1999动物行为研究协会。
